Blues Fest starts Sunday at Craighead Forest Park

Jonesboro, AR – Blues Fest 2011 gets underway this Sunday afternoon at Craighead Forest Park in Jonesboro. The free music festival is held each year at the bandshell on Access Road 6. Craighead Lake provides the backdrop, as a variety of local and regional musicians perform beginning at 1 p.m. this Sunday, and for the following two Sundays in September. "Harry Larry" Heyl, Jonesboro bluesman and host of "Something Blue" on KASU stopped by Morning Edition to talk about Blues Fest....

Pocahontas man bikes across the country, helping build homes along the way

Jonesboro, AR – Dustin Smith of Pocahontas bicycled from coast to coast across America over the summer, helping build affordable housing along the way. He was one of over 200 cyclists participating in a program called Bike & Build. KASU talked with him when he was training for his trip. Now he's back to tell us how it went....

Entertainer Ed Underwood "Bringing Spooky Back" to Jonesboro

Jonesboro, AR – Ed Underwood of Jonesboro will be signing copies of his book "Haunted Jonesboro" on Saturday, September 24th, at 2 p.m., at The Edge Coffeehouse. His company, Special Occasions Entertainment, performs the Ghost Hours Show at various locations. And he's bringing back Ghost Tours in downtown Jonesboro in October. He materialized in the KASU studio to talk about it all....
